## Timetable Solver Restart

The Slatebridge solver accepts plugin constraint packs at startup only. If a plugin fails validation, the solver discards the whole pack and continues with built-in rules, logging the rejection. Plugin authors should confirm their pack version matches the solver's declared schema before requesting a restart. Restarts drain in-flight solve jobs within two minutes. To verify your pack loaded correctly, compare the active runtime settings, which are reproduced below.

settings of tagef-bawif:
DRUIX_HOST=druix.zemvarlabs.internal
DRUIX_PORT=8000

// Crankshaft stored jobs in a shared table with no auth boundary; Drayline
// enforces per-tenant scopes and signed payloads, which closes the privilege
// escalation noted in last quarter's audit. Retry and dead-letter behavior
// are configured server-side, so nothing security-relevant lives in this
// file except credentials. The client authenticates to Drayline's internal
// endpoint using the key directly below this comment.

service key, tadup-tahog: zpat7_wB1tnEL

Subject: Pilot Update — Fernway Stores

Executive team,

The Fernway Stores pilot went live in twelve locations last week. Basket-scan accuracy is at 97%, and store managers report minimal disruption at checkout. Fernway's buying team has asked about terms for a wider rollout. The strategic detail we discussed, restricted to the board, appears immediately below.

board note of fafog-yahap: Project Rusdor slips by a full year because of the audit delay.